pengertian xml
XML adalah salah satu bahasa markup yang ciptakan oleh konsorsium World Wide Web (W3C). Fungsinya adalah untuk menyederhanakan proses penyimpanan dan pengiriman data antar server.
Proses penyimpanan dan pengiriman data sangat memerlukan penyederhanaan karena perbedaan sistem pada setiap server, sehingga jika sistem tidak cocok akan memakan waktu lebih lama. Anda harus melakukan perubahan terhadap format data agar sesuai dengan server tujuan.
Sebagai solusi atas permasalahan tersebut, XML menyimpan data ke dalam format sederhana, sehingga Anda tidak perlu melakukan perubahan sama sekali terhadap data. Format XML adalah berupa teks yang tidak akan berubah, bahkan saat Anda transfer ke server lain dan mudah untuk diperbarui ke sistem operasi maupun browser baru. Bahasanya juga sangat mudah Anda pahami.
XML sendiri sering anggap mirip dengan HTML. Baik XML dan HTML mengandung simbol-simbol markup yang berfungsi untuk mendeskripsikan konten sebuah halaman atau file.
Kendati demikian, HTML hanya mendeskripsikan konten dari sebuah laman web sesuai dengan bagaimana halaman tersebut perlu tampilkan pada user.
Misalnya, huruf ‘p’ yang tempatkan di dalam tag markup berfungsi untuk memulai paragraf baru.
Sementara itu, menjelaskan konten sesuai dengan data apa yang sedang digambarkan oleh program.
Misalnya, kata ‘phonenum’ yang tempatkan di dalam tag markup dapat menunjukkan bahwa data yang digunakan menggambarkan sebuah nomor telepon.
File dapat proses sepenuhnya sebagai data oleh sebuah program atau dapat simpan dengan data yang serupa dalam komputer lain.
Ia juga dapat tampilkan, seperti file HTML. Misalnya, aplikasi pada komputer penerima akan menentukan cara menangani file. Apakah akan simpan, tampilkan, atau justru putar.
Nah, yang membedakan dengan markup league lain adalah bahwa file-nya dengan mudah dapat perluas oleh pengguna.
Tidak seperti HTML, simbol markup yang miliki jumlahnya tidak terbatas dan dapat definisikan sendiri oleh penggunanya.
XML sering anggap sebagai subset standar SGML atau standard generalized markup language yang lebih sederhana dan mudah gunakan untuk membuat struktur dokumen.
Biasanya, XML dan HTML akan gunakan bersama pada banyak aplikasi web. Misalnya, markup XML mungkin akan sering terlihat dalam sebuah halaman HTML.
0 Komentar